SR Nair - US Patent 9,910,689, 2018 - Google Patents
A system and method for providing dynamic I/O virtualization is herein disclosed. According to one embodiment, a device capable of performing hypervisor-agnostic and device …
J Nieh, N Viennot, O Laadan - US Patent 8,402,318, 2013 - Google Patents
(57) ABSTRACT A method for recording and replaying execution of an appli cation running on a computer system using a program module is provided. The method includes recording …
IQ Sayed, BT Kolin - US Patent 8,433,733, 2013 - Google Patents
BACKGROUND The advancement of runtime environments that are embed ded in web browsers, such as Java, JavaScript and Flash has given rise to an increase in the …
LC Heller, PM West Jr, PC Yeh - US Patent 9,449,314, 2016 - Google Patents
A central processing unit measurement facility is virtualized in order to support concurrent use of the facility by multiple guests executing within a virtual environment. Each guest of the …
S Nair - US Patent 10,031,767, 2018 - Google Patents
A system and method for providing dynamic information virtualization (DIV) is disclosed. According to one embodiment, a device includes a dynamic optimization manager (DOM), a …
AK Warfield - US Patent 8,549,516, 2013 - Google Patents
A system for controlling, by a hypervisor, access to physical resources during execution of a virtual machine includes a physical disk and a hypervisor. The physical disk is provided by a …
SR Nair - US Patent 9,384,024, 2016 - Google Patents
A system and method for providing dynamic device virtualization is herein disclosed. According to one embodiment, the computer-implemented method includes observing a …
M Marron - US Patent 10,268,567, 2019 - Google Patents
Systems, methods, and computer-readable media are dis closed for using managed runtime environment semantics to optimize record and replay frameworks. One method includes …
J Chow, T Garfinkel, D Lucchetti - US Patent 8,656,222, 2014 - Google Patents
One or more embodiments of the invention provide meth ods and systems for recording a selected computer process for Subsequent replay. When an application is selected for recor …